As we age, our lifestyle choices can significantly impact our overall wellness. Making specific changes can help seniors lead healthier, happier lives.
Eating a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ins is vital for maintaining health. Consider meal planning to ensure you're getting the nutrients needed.
Regular exercise, even in small amounts, can help maintain mobility and strength. Find activities that you enjoy and incorporate them into your routine.
Staying socially active can enhance mental health. Join clubs, participate in community events, or connect with friends and family regularly.
Keep your mind sharp by engaging in puzzles, reading, or learning new skills. Mental exercises can prevent cognitive decline.
Prioritize sleep to support overall health. Establish a regular sleep schedule and create a comfortable sleeping environment.
Implementing these lifestyle changes can dramatically improve wellness in seniors. Start small and gradually make these adjustments to enjoy a healthier life.
